Стили

Так как за основу взяты рекомендации консорциума W3C, следует придерживаться следующих правил.

1.  Не использовать устарелые теги  для форматирования и расположения типа: <b>, <u>, <i>, <strike>, <font>. Вместо них использовать стили.

2.  Не использовать параметры (align, valign, width и т.д.), а использовать стили (text-alignvertical-align, width и т.п.).

3.  Если для нескольких элементов требуется одинаковый стиль, то его нужно указывать у родительского элемента, а не прописывать одно и то же у всех элементов, если это возможно.

         так не надо:

 <div>
 <field class="doc_title">Номер</field>
 <field class="doc_title">Дата</field>
 </div>

            а надо так:

<div class="doc_title">
 <field>Номер</field>
 <field>Дата</field>
</div>

4.  Однако не удастся задать границы ячеек таблицы у самой таблицы,, например:

            так не получится:

<tr class="doc_label">
 <td></td>
 <td></td>
</tr>

            надо так:

<tr>
 <td class="doc_label"></td>
 <td class="doc_label"></td>
</tr>

5.  Тег <style> используется для переопределения стандартных стилей, чаще всего для изменения размера шрифта и выравнивания. Рекомендуется выносить все стили в отдельные css-файлы, а в теге <style> только переопределять локально отдельные стили.